Why Daily Wellness Feels So Hard

Wellness often gets presented as an all-or-nothing approach. New routines. Strict plans. Big changes. Resolutions (we've all been there).

But real life doesn’t work that way. Schedules shift. Energy fluctuates. Motivation comes and goes. Mental health is a rollercoaster journey for some, and a lot of what we do both for ourselves, and others, happens amongst those highs and lows of life.

When wellness feels complicated, it becomes difficult to maintain. And when it’s difficult to maintain, it doesn’t last.

Daily wellness works best when it feels simple, flexible, enjoyable and repeatable.

Why Small Habits Matter More Than Big Changes

There's a reason why small habits outperform big changes over time: They're easier to repeat.

When something is easy, it becomes automatic. And when it becomes automatic, it becomes part of your lifestyle.

Daily wellness is built on this idea. Instead of trying to overhaul everything at once, focus on what you can do every day.

That might be:

→ Taking your vitamins with breakfast

→ Drinking a glass of water in the morning

→ Choosing one balanced meal

These small actions may seem minor, but over time, they compound.

Building a Routine That Actually Sticks

A strong daily wellness routine does not rely on motivation. It relies on structure.

The most effective routines are:

• Easy to follow

• Built into existing habits

• Flexible enough to adapt

For example, pairing your vitamin with something you already do every day, like breakfast or brushing your teeth, removes the need to remember.

It becomes automatic.

Hydration and Daily Wellness

Hydration is one of the simplest and most overlooked parts of daily wellness.

Water supports nearly every system in the body, including energy, digestion, and nutrient transport.

Even mild dehydration can affect how you feel throughout the day.

Making hydration part of your daily wellness routine does not need to be complicated. It can be as simple as keeping water accessible and building it into your day.

Why Consistency Beats Perfection

Perfection is not sustainable. Consistency is. Missing a day does not undo progress. What matters is returning to your routine and continuing forward. 

Daily wellness is not about getting everything right every day. It's more about maintaining a rhythm over time.

When habits are simple and flexible, it becomes easier to stay consistent, even when life gets busy.

Daily Wellness for Families

Daily wellness becomes even more important in a family setting.

Parents are not just building habits for themselves. They are modeling habits for their children. When kids see consistent routines around nutrition, hydration, and supplementation, those behaviors become normalized.

This is how long-term habits are formed.
